Time 30m

Yield 12

Number Of Ingredients 3

1 (16.5 ounce) package NESTLE® TOLL HOUSE® Refrigerated Chocolate Chip Cookie Bar Dough
4 tablespoons yogurt, divided
Cut-up fresh fruit of choice

Steps:

  • Press two squares of dough together. Place in prepared muffin cups.
  • Bake for 20 to 24 minutes or until golden brown. Cool completely in pan on wire rack*. Center of cups will indent slightly upon cooling. With tip of butter knife, remove cookie cups from muffin pan.
  • Fill cookie cups as desired.
  • Yogurt & Fruit Cookie Cups: Top each with a spoonful of yogurt and cut-up fresh fruit of choice.
